Как перевести число из двоичной системы в десятичную

Редакция Просто интернет
Дата 17 февраля 2024
Поделиться

Двоичная система счисления является основой для работы компьютеров, поэтому знание, как перевести число из двоичной системы в десятичную, может быть полезным для понимания работы компьютеров и программирования. В этой статье мы рассмотрим подробное руководство по переводу числа из двоичной системы в десятичную.

Перевод числа из двоичной системы в десятичную осуществляется путем умножения каждой цифры двоичного числа на 2 в степени, соответствующей ее позиции, и суммирования полученных значений. Например, если дано двоичное число 10110, то переводим его следующим образом: 1*2^4 + 0*2^3 + 1*2^2 + 1*2^1 + 0*2^0 = 22.

Чтобы перевести число из двоичной системы в десятичную, необходимо использовать позиционную систему счисления, где каждая цифра имеет свою весовую степень. Самая правая цифра имеет весовую степень 2^0, следующая цифра имеет весовую степень 2^1, затем 2^2 и так далее. Если цифра равна 1, то она приносит свою весовую степень в общую сумму, если цифра равна 0, то она не приносит никакого значения.

Двоичная система счисления

Двоичная система счисления является одной из основных систем счисления, которую использовали уже в древности, но она получила особую популярность благодаря развитию компьютерных технологий. В двоичной системе счисления используется всего две цифры — 0 и 1, что означает, что она является позиционной системой, где каждая позиция имеет вес в два раза больший, чем предыдущая.

В двоичной системе счисления числа записываются справа налево, где младший бит расположен на самом правом месте числа, а старший бит — на самом левом. Каждая позиция имеет вес, соответствующий двойке в степени номера позиции, начиная с нулевой позиции справа.

Например, двоичное число 1011 означает:

Чтобы перевести двоичное число в десятичное, нужно сложить произведения каждой позиции на соответствующий вес позиции. Например, чтобы перевести число 1011 в десятичную систему, нужно выполнить следующее вычисление:

  1. 1 * 2^3 = 8
  2. 0 * 2^2 = 0
  3. 1 * 2^1 = 2
  4. 1 * 2^0 = 1

После чего нужно сложить все полученные произведения:

8 + 0 + 2 + 1 = 11

Итак, двоичное число 1011 в десятичной системе равно 11.

Двоичная система счисления широко применяется в компьютерах и цифровых устройствах, поскольку она позволяет представлять числа с помощью всего двух символов и обеспечивает простоту вычислений с двоичными числами. Важно иметь навык перевода чисел из двоичной системы в десятичную и наоборот для работы с памятью компьютера, анализа данных и разработки программного обеспечения.

Десятичная система счисления

Десятичная система счисления – это одна из самых распространенных систем, которая использует цифры от 0 до 9. Десятичная система счисления основана на позиционной записи чисел, что означает, что значение цифры в числе зависит от ее позиции.

В десятичной системе счисления каждая позиция числа имеет вес, который равен 10 в степени позиции. Например, число 243 в десятичной системе счисления можно разложить на сумму:

Суммируя все вместе, получим число 243.

Десятичная система счисления широко используется в повседневной жизни и во многих областях, таких как математика, физика, экономика и программирование. Она позволяет удобно работать с целыми и десятичными числами, а также проводить различные арифметические операции.

Однако в компьютерной технике для внутреннего представления чисел обычно используется двоичная система счисления, поэтому иногда требуется переводить числа из десятичной системы в двоичную и наоборот.

Используя правила позиционной системы счисления и вес каждой позиции, вы можете легко перевести число из десятичной системы в другую систему счисления, такую как двоичная или шестнадцатеричная.

Как перевести число из двоичной системы в десятичную

Двоичная система – система счисления, которая использует только две цифры: 0 и 1. В этой системе каждая цифра называется битом, а числа записываются в виде последовательности битов.

Перевод числа из двоичной системы в десятичную может быть выполнен следующим образом:

  1. Записываем число в двоичной системе.
  2. Присваиваем каждой цифре числа позицию, начиная с нуля.
  3. Умножаем каждую цифру числа на 2 в степени ее позиции.
  4. Суммируем получившиеся произведения.

Например, рассмотрим число 10110(2) (или 22(10)).

Умножим каждую цифру числа на 2 в степени ее позиции:

Суммируем получившиеся произведения: 16 + 0 + 4 + 2 + 0 = 22.

Таким образом, число 10110(2) в двоичной системе равно числу 22(10) в десятичной системе.

Зная этот простой алгоритм, вы можете переводить числа из двоичной системы в десятичную.

Вопрос-ответ

Как перевести число из двоичной системы в десятичную?

Для перевода числа из двоичной системы в десятичную систему нужно умножить каждую цифру двоичного числа на 2 в степени, которая соответствует ее положению, и затем сложить все полученные произведения. Например, для числа 1010 мы умножаем 1 на 2 в степени 3, 0 на 2 в степени 2, 1 на 2 в степени 1 и 0 на 2 в степени 0, а затем складываем полученные значения: 8 + 0 + 2 + 0 = 10. Таким образом, число 1010 в двоичной системе равно числу 10 в десятичной системе.

Можно ли использовать таблицу для перевода из двоичной системы в десятичную?

Да, можно использовать таблицу для чисел с небольшим количеством бит. В таблице перечислены двоичные числа и соответствующие им десятичные значения. Например, для числа 1010 можно найти соответствующее ему значение 10 в таблице. Однако, для чисел с большим количеством бит таблица может быть неудобна, и в этом случае следует использовать алгоритм умножения каждой цифры на 2 в соответствующей степени.

Как перевести отрицательное число из двоичной системы в десятичную?

Перевод отрицательного числа из двоичной системы в десятичную проводится аналогично переводу положительного числа. Однако, для правильного интерпретации числа как отрицательного в десятичной системе, необходимо учесть знаковый разряд числа. Если самый левый разряд числа равен 1, то число является отрицательным, и перед переводом в десятичную систему следует инвертировать все биты числа и прибавить 1. Например, для числа 1111, чтобы получить его десятичное значение, мы инвертируем все биты (0000) и прибавляем 1, получаем число -1.

Разделы сайта

1C Adobe Android AutoCAD Blender CorelDRAW CSS Discord Excel Figma Gimp Gmail Google HTML iPad iPhone JavaScript LibreOffice Linux Mail.ru MineCraft Ozon Paint PDF PowerPoint Python SketchUp Telegram Tilda Twitch Viber WhatsApp Windows Word ВКонтакте География Госуслуги История Компас Литература Математика Ошибки Тик Ток Тинькофф Физика Химия